But visitors to Sunflower Van Geaux last month weren’t there to eat or even clean with lemons, they were there to paint them!
Lemons was a public painting event, where artists and their families learned little tips and tricks on how to paint.
Lonnie Ryland joined his daughter Lacie and granddaughter Piper at the paint party, along with his niece and her friend. Other families joined as well for a full studio of artists. Painters are encouraged to bring their own food and drinks, along with their friends and family for a total experience.
Sunflower Van Geaux ART Studio is located in the center of the Plaza 28 building. The address is 6501 Coliseum Blvd, Alexandria. They provide everything you need art lessons and paint party events. You need only bring your creativity and enjoy the artistic atmosphere!
“Everyone is an artist! It may not look like mine, but it’s not supposed to! I love how everyone’s painting ends up as their own version of the same painting with their own style added to it,” owner Allie Robertson shares.
